SHOPPING RAMPAGE | Part Three: MAC Cosmetics

So, ladies and gents, here we are; I'm finally uploading the third part of my huge shopping rampage, my MAC haul! Surprisingly I didn't order much for myself but I did I pick up a few bits 'n' pieces which will be featuring in an exciting post tomorrow. I am actually quite surprised at how little I bought but, hey, there's a first for everything!!

First, I bought four more eyeshadow pans for my 15 Pan MAC Pro Palette. These are all colours I've been lusting over these colours for a really long time but have refused to pay AU prices for them, especially because nowhere in Perth sells the pans.
MAC Quarry | MAC Sweet Lust | MAC Cranberry | MAC Woodwinked
MAC Woodwinked | MAC Quarry | MAC Sweet Lust | MAC Cranberry

QUARRY: Soft muted plum-brown (matte)
SWEET LUST: Pinky rose (frost)
CRANBERRY: Red-plum with pink shimmer (frost)
WOODWINKED: Warm antique gold (veluxe pearl)

I'm so excited to own Cranberry. it's a shade I've been really wanting to try for quite some time now and, even though I've only worn it once or twice, I think it's absolutely beautiful already! In saying that though, I love every colour I picked up. I think MAC eyeshadows are some of the best!

I also picked up another product that I've wanted to try for so long because of those damn Pixiwoo girls, MAC's Glitter in Reflects Gold. This is a beautiful glitter that applies transparent but, as the name suggest, reflects gold. I've worn it once so far and I  can't wait to use it more. 

To be honest, I've very proud of the amount I picked up for myself. My MAC shopping list is always absolutely huge so it's surprising that I limited myself to just a couple of products. Rimmel London Apocalips* Lip Lacquer Review and Swatches

The Rimmel Apocalips* have been receiving a lot of love in the beauty community lately. They were released in the UK a towards the start of the year and, in the last month or so, have hit Australia's shores. If you saw my ASOS cosmetics haul from April (click here to see it), you'll know that I picked up Luna (also known as Phenomenon for us Australians) and Nova, a light peach/coral and a mid toned somewhat dusty pink.
Top to Bottom: Stellar*, Apocalip*s, Nova, Phenomenon (aka Luna) and Stargazer*

"The intense colour of a lipstick with a smooth lacquer shine? Impossible, right? Wrong! New Apocalips* Lip Lacquer combines the best of both worlds with its ground-breaking formula - a luscious liquid packed with pure colour pigments for rich colour, phenomenal shine and supreme comfort that lasts all day. The lip lacquer formula gives your lips colour so strong and bold that your pout is bound to make an impact!"
- Rimmel London Apocalips Lip Lacquer Media Release

Essence Stays No Matter What Waterproof Eye Pencil Review and Swatches

I don't wear eyeliner that much but, when I do, I want it to be a good one. Essence is one of my favourite cosmetic brands so it's no surprise that I absolutely love the Essence Stays No Matter What Waterproof Eyepencils. 

"Party-proof for up to 16 hours! This plastic pencil kajal can be sharpened - and it stays put! The creamy, soft texture offers great coverage and won't smudge. It is also waterproof and lasts all day (and all night). Made of PVC-free material with a high coverage, the eye pencil won't melt at temperatures below 40c. Available in three STAYS No Matter What colours; #01 Midnight Black, #02 Stunning Brown and #03 Smokey Grey. RRP $2.50" 
- Essence Media Release
Essence Stays No Matter What Waterproof Eyepencils in #01 Midnight Black and #02 Stunning Brown

As I'm sure you can see from the photos above, I have the Essence Stays No Matter What Waterproof Eyepencil in two colours; #01 Midnight Black and #02 Stunning Brown. Both eye liners are incredibly pigmented and glide onto the eye beautifully, regardless of where they're applied.

These eyeliners are some of the smoothest liners I've ever tried, something that I really appreciated as someone who doesn't use eyeliner on a regular basis. The pencil itself is a perfect width and weight, meaning the user has optimum control over the line they're creating. There's nothing worse than using a liner you just can't control! Not only do they apply smoothly, they blend out with absolute ease.

For a more diffused line, I find myself applying the liner to one eye at a time and blending it out with an angled brush. With an eyeliner like this it's important to be quick. When this eyeliner sets it doesn't move, much like the name suggests. 

Not only does this eyeliner stay incredibly well on the upper lash line, it stays on my tight line longer than almost every other eyeliner I've tried. Whilst it does transfer to my waterline a little, it's not a lot and, unless you were looking for it, you probably wouldn't. I don't ever apply dark liner to my waterline as I think it completely closes off my eyes but I suspect it would wear just as well as it does on my tightline.

As I said at the beginning of this post, I don't gravitate towards eyeliner that often (using powder in place of liner a majority of the time) but this is the one I've been reaching for whenever I want a more defined line.

Whether you're an eyeliner amateur or connoisseur, I highly recommend you pick up these eyeliners. At a mere $2.50, the only thing I can fault about the whole product is the fact that it needs to be sharpened.
